Texas: Governor Abbott, HHSC Announce SNAP Replacement Benefits Extension Following Winter Storm
Rezul News/10726416
~ In a recent announcement, Governor Greg Abbott revealed that the Texas Health and Human Services Commission (HHSC) has been granted federal approval to extend the deadline for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) recipients to apply for replacement benefits for food lost or destroyed during the January winter storm.
The extension, made possible through collaboration with the White House, will provide much-needed relief to Texans who were affected by the severe weather conditions. Governor Abbott expressed his gratitude towards the Trump administration and HHSC for their support in helping families recover from the aftermath of the storm.
According to HHS Executive Commissioner Stephanie Muth, many communities were left in difficult situations due to the winter storm and subsequent power outages. The extension of the replacement benefit deadline will offer crucial support to families who are still struggling to bounce back from the disaster.

SNAP recipients in Texas now have until February 23, 2026, to apply for replacement benefits. These funds will be added to their Lone Star Cards within two business days of submitting a request. To request a benefit replacement, recipients must visit a local HHSC office. The YourTexasBenefits.com website provides a convenient tool for locating nearby offices.
For those impacted by any disaster, including the recent winter storm, HHSC has set up a webpage dedicated to receiving disaster assistance. Additionally, individuals can dial 2-1-1 and select option 1 to access local resources such as food and shelter.
This extension of SNAP benefits is just one example of how government agencies are working together to support those in need during times of crisis. With this additional time and assistance, Texans can better provide for their families and continue on their path towards recovery.
